A reliable childcare will require pets to be updated on their vaccinations & have a titer examination done. They ought to also guarantee their employee are learnt family pet first aid & MOUTH-TO-MOUTH RESUSCITATION.
On top of that, they must have a low staff-to-dog ratio to make sure that each canine is effectively taken care of and checked. The facility must be clean and well ventilated.
1. Examine the Facility
Much like you would not send your children to college without a personal trip, you need to check out the childcare facility prior to leaving your pet there. Inspect the kennels and play areas to see just how clean they are. Ask what treatments they have in place to prevent injuries and just how they handle behavioral concerns.
A trusted childcare will have plenty of outside locations for dogs to be active in and play openly. Make sure they have a procedure for separating scuffles and make use of only positive support methods that are shown to be secure and reliable for the animals. They must additionally have a clear incident assessment process and connect well with pet dog parents about any type of cases that take place at the facility. Red flags include not connecting concerning any events, not examining the pet dogs after a case, and using methods like force or water to separate scuffles that could trigger injury. These strategies are antiquated and scientifically shown to be dangerous for dogs, both physically and emotionally.
2. Ask Concerns
Asking concerns is just one of one of the most important things you can do when buying pet daycare. Whether it's about safety protocols, personnel credentials, or day-to-day timetables, getting clear answers equips you with an alternative understanding of the facility.
Inquire about the day care's technique to food timetables, pause, and enrichment tasks, as these are essential parts of your dogs overall care. In addition, a reliable facility ought to provide transparency in their everyday procedures by offering a web cam and offering trips.
You can likewise inquire about the day care's screening processes and how they determine if your pet is appropriate for their team (e.g., personality tests, play teams based upon dimension and play style). Likewise, ask about emergency situation accessibility as you would love to recognize that they have a strategy in place for situations that arise such as battles or wellness dilemmas. Inquire about what animal medical training and certifications their staff members have, too.
3. Take an Excursion
A high quality daycare relies on repeat customers, so take some time to see the facility. Look for home windows or sites that supply a view into the childcare space and the kennels. Look for red flags like an unclean center or inconsistent cleaning timetable. Eco-friendly flags include a clearly laid out daily process and a staff-to-dog ratio that allows for customized interest.
Ask what education or training the team has in pet actions and pet dog training. A trustworthy day care should have methods in position for handling problem and hostility between pets in addition to for managing overstimulation throughout group play.
It's additionally a great idea to speak with current consumers and get their responses. This can provide you insight right into the pros and cons of a particular day care and help you make an extra informed choice that aligns with your pet dog's requirements and assumptions. A strong recommendation from a pleased customer is a powerful marketing point. Furthermore, unfavorable responses can inform you to feasible issues.
